About The Position

The Events Registration & Technology Specialist plays a critical role in supporting the planning, execution, and continuous improvement of organizational events and meetings, with a primary focus on event registration, communication, and housing builds using event technology. This role is responsible for configuring and managing event registration platforms, supporting event operations, and ensuring accurate, timely communication and reporting. Working closely with the Events team and internal stakeholders, this position helps deliver seamless event experiences by leveraging technology and supporting standardized processes for 5–10 large-scale events.

Responsibilities

  • Configure and manage registration for 5–10 large-scale events annually within the Event Management System (Cvent).
  • Translate event requirements from request into accurate registration builds, including attendee types, workflows, and communications.
  • Partner with Events team members to ensure timely and accurate setup of all events in alignment with established processes and timelines.
  • Maintain and update registration templates, standards, and best practices to improve efficiency and consistency.
  • Generate and distribute event registration and housing reports to support planning, decision-making, and stakeholder needs.
  • Monitor registration activity, identify discrepancies or data anomalies, and implement timely resolutions.
  • Support and help build event registration.
  • Support implementation and management of Passkey for housing, enabling real-time hotel reservations with secure payment processing.
  • Improve operational efficiency through automation and real-time updates.
  • Enhance the attendee experience with a seamless self-service booking process.
  • Support the events team in modernizing and scaling housing operations.
  • Support the execution of event technology operations, including system configuration, testing, and quality assurance (QA).
  • Create and manage attendee communications, including confirmations, reminders, updates, and cancellations.
  • Maintain and support a centralized “single source of truth” for all meetings and events calendars within the event management platform.
  • Conduct end-to-end testing of registration builds using test profiles to ensure accuracy and functionality.
  • Collaborate with internal teams to support event readiness and onsite success as needed.
  • Document registration requirements, workflows, and system configurations to ensure consistency and knowledge sharing.
  • Maintain user guides, process flows, and standard operating procedures related to event technology and reporting.
